titleOfInvention |
Antisense Oligonucleotide Compositions |
abstract |
The present invention relates to antisense oligonucleotide (ASO) compositions, and in particular to compositions and methods for cytoplasmic delivery of antisense oligonucleotides (ASO). A partially single-stranded and partially double-stranded hybrid ASO is provided that hybridizes to form a double-stranded region that can non-covalently bond to the nucleic acid binding protein region. In this way, ASO::protein complexes can be produced that facilitate delivery of antisense DNA into target cells. Such complexes can be used to downregulate gene expression in cells. |
